# 1. The Evolution of Seismic Modeling Techniques

Seismic modeling has come a long way since the early days of using 2D surveys. Today, the industry is witnessing a shift towards more sophisticated 3D and 4D (time-lapse) seismic imaging techniques. These advancements not only enhance our ability to visualize underground structures but also provide unprecedented insights into dynamic processes within the Earth. For instance, 4D seismic imaging is revolutionizing the way we monitor reservoir behavior, aiding in more accurate fluid management and optimizing production strategies.

Key Innovations:

- AI and Machine Learning: These technologies are being integrated into seismic data processing to automate complex tasks, improve accuracy, and reduce human error.

- High-Performance Computing (HPC): Advanced computational resources are enabling more detailed and faster simulations, which is critical for large-scale projects.

# 3. Future Developments in Seismic Modeling

As we look to the future, several trends are likely to shape the seismic modeling landscape. One of the most promising areas is the integration of multi-disciplinary data, including geophysical, geological, and geochemical data, to create more comprehensive models. Additionally, advancements in sub-surface data fusion and artificial intelligence are expected to further enhance predictive capabilities.

Key Future Developments:

- Sub-Surface Data Fusion: Combining data from various sources to create a more accurate and detailed picture of the subsurface environment.

- AI-Driven Predictions: Using machine learning algorithms to predict seismic events and optimize drilling operations in real-time.

- Quantum Computing: While still in the experimental stage, quantum computing has the potential to revolutionize seismic modeling by enabling faster and more complex simulations.
